Gabon is emerging as a regional leader in sustainable energy solutions, with energy storage power stations playing a pivotal role in its renewable energy transition. This article explores active projects, government initiatives, and innovative technologies shaping Gabon's energy storage landscape.
Current Energy Storage Projects in Gabon
Gabon's energy sector has seen remarkable progress through these flagship initiatives:
- Kinguélé Hydropower Storage Complex - 73 MW capacity with integrated battery storage
- Libreville Solar+Storage Hybrid Plant - 50 MWh lithium-ion battery system
- Port-Gentil Microgrid Project - 12 MWh community-scale storage solution
Market Drivers and Growth Projections
Three key factors are accelerating energy storage adoption:
- Government target of 80% renewable energy by 2030
- Falling battery costs (32% reduction since 2018)
- Increasing electricity demand (4.7% annual growth)
| Project Type | Installed Capacity (2023) | Projected Capacity (2030) |
|---|---|---|
| Utility-Scale Storage | 145 MWh | 800 MWh |
| Distributed Systems | 28 MWh | 350 MWh |
Technological Advancements
Gabon's storage solutions combine cutting-edge technologies:
- Second-life battery applications
- AI-powered energy management systems
- Modular containerized storage units
Want to know how these innovations work in practice? Let's break it down. The modular systems allow rapid deployment in remote areas - perfect for Gabon's diverse geography. Meanwhile, AI optimization helps balance supply and demand in real-time.
Implementation Challenges
Despite progress, developers face:
- Grid interconnection complexities
- Technical workforce shortages
- Financing hurdles for large-scale projects
Future Development Roadmap
Gabon's energy storage sector is expected to:
- Integrate with West African Power Pool
- Develop 200+ MWh of pumped hydro storage
- Implement smart grid technologies nationwide
With 60% of the country still without reliable electricity, the potential for growth is enormous. Energy storage isn't just about technology - it's about powering communities and enabling economic development.
